
Top 10 Departments In a Global Corporation
- Posted by Ryan Anthony
- Categories Blog, Business
- Date February 9, 2025
A business structure depends on the size and management of the organization. Businesses tend to start off small where many functions are carried out by a small number of employees and managers. As the company grows it becomes important to have a structured approach to the business and that the company needs to define and implement a top down integrated collaborative structure. First Business English provides here a typical business structure that global corporations adopt when competing in the global market place. The top 10 structured departments are outlined here.
- Executive Leadership
Executive leadership plays a critical role in the success of a global corporation. The executives at the top of the organizational hierarchy are responsible for making high-level strategic decisions that guide the company’s direction and ensure its long-term success. This includes the CEO, board of directors, and other top-level executives responsible for setting the overall strategic direction of the company. Learn More.
- Finance Department
The finance department is one of the most critical departments in any organization, and this is especially true for global corporations. The function of the finance department in a global corporation is to manage the financial resources of the organization in such a way as to maximize profitability and minimize risk. This involves a wide range of activities, from financial analysis and reporting to budgeting and forecasting. Learn More.
- Human Resources Department
The Human Resources (HR) department are an integral to the success of global corporations. The HR department plays a vital role in ensuring that the company has the right talent to achieve its goals and objectives. The HR department is responsible for managing employee recruitment, training, development, benefits, and employee relations. Learn More.
- Marketing Department
The marketing department plays a critical role in the success of any corporation. The function of the marketing department is to create, promote, and sell products or services to customers in a way that maximizes the company’s profitability while also meeting the needs of the target market. We will explore the function of the marketing department in a global corporation and how it helps the company achieve its objectives. Learn More.
- Sales Department
The Sales department is responsible for identifying and targeting potential customers, developing relationships with them, and ultimately converting them into paying customers. They also work to retain existing customers by providing them with excellent customer service and support. Sales teams are often segmented based on geography, product lines, or customer types, depending on the size and complexity of the corporation. Learn More.
- Operations Department
The Operations department is a critical component of any global corporation. Its primary function is to ensure that the company’s day-to-day activities run smoothly and efficiently. The department is responsible for managing all the resources necessary to produce the company’s goods and services, including people, equipment, materials, and technology. It also plays a key role in ensuring that the company’s products are of high quality, delivered on time, and meet customer expectations. Learn More.
- Information Technology Department
The IT department’s primary function is to manage the company’s computer networks, hardware, and software systems. They are responsible for installing, configuring, and maintaining all the technology used within the organization. The department also develops and implements policies and procedures for data security, network performance, backup and recovery and IT Helpdesk functions. Learn More.
- Legal Department
The legal department’s primary function in a global corporation is to ensure that the company operates within the bounds of the law. This means that the legal team must have a deep understanding of the laws and regulations that apply to the company’s operations in every country where it operates. This department provides legal advice and support to the company, including contract negotiation, intellectual property protection, and compliance with laws and regulations. Learn More.
- Research and Development Department
The primary function of the R&D department in a global corporation is to conduct research and development activities that can lead to the creation of new products, services, or processes. This department is responsible for identifying new market opportunities, assessing the feasibility of new products and technologies, and developing new and improved products or services. Learn More.
- Corporate Social Responsibility Department
The function of the CSR department in a global corporation is complex. Its primary role is to develop and implement the corporation’s CSR strategy. This involves identifying the areas where the corporation can make the most significant impact in terms of social, environmental, and economic sustainability. The CSR department works with various stakeholders, including employees, customers, suppliers, and the community, to develop and implement initiatives that address these areas. Learn More.
First Business English is a premium business English language online education center that provides individuals and groups the opportunity to learn Business English that enhances their careers and lives through a structured Business English curriculum. Contact Us
Ryan Anthony is an enthusiastic, self-motivated, reliable Online Business English language tutor who is learner focused and highly adaptable. Bachelor of Business Studies Degree educated with extensive IT Support, Call Centre Management, Retail Management and English Language Teaching experience.
You may also like

The Pros And Cons Of Freelancing As A Career

The Effect Of Prices And The Cost Of Living
